  4. Marlin, any of several species of large long-nosed marine fishes of the family Istiophoridae (order Perciformes) that have an elongated body, a long dorsal fin, and a rounded spear extending from the snout.

  5. What is Marlin? Marlin is an open source firmware for the RepRap family of replicating rapid prototypers — popularly known as “3D printers.” Originally derived from Sprinter and grbl , Marlin became a standalone open source project on August 12, 2011 with its Github release .
